According to Corriere dello Sport, AS Roma have rejected an offer from Atletico Madrid for the services of Manu Kone. The Giallorossi maintain that the 25-year-old midfielder is not for sale, but their resolve could be tested again with the Rojiblancos not giving up, and the likes of Manchester United and Liverpool monitoring the situation closely. Apparently, €60 million could be enough to change Roma’s stance.
Kone joined Roma from Borussia Monchengladbach two years ago for a reported fee of €18 million, but his stock has risen significantly since, particularly since his World Cup performances with France helped him establish himself as an important part of Didier Deschamps’ team. He has so far made 82 appearances for the Serie A club, scoring four goals and contributing six assists from his position in the middle of the park, while earning 18 caps for his country.
United have so far completed the signing of Andrey Santos from Chelsea and are on the verge of completing the transfer of Youri Tielemans from Aston Villa, while Liverpool are yet to make a midfield signing this summer.
